Usain Bolt’s 100m World Record 9.72 – 31st May 2007, New York
On 31st May 2007 at the Reebok Grand Prix at the Icahn Stadium on Randall’s Island in New York, Usain Bolt broke the World 100m record in 9.72 seconds.
